Argos

Argos is a UK retail chain which offers a wide range of general merchandise across its online shopping uk electronics and store networks. Customers can shop through its website along with mobile channels, 800 stores and via the phone. The company also offers home delivery services, as well as click and pick up.

Argos is known for being one of the most well-known catalog retailers in the amazon uk online shopping clothes. The traditional method of shopping included filling out a small order form with catalogue numbers of the items that you want. Customers were given red pencils (formerly blue ones) in the shops for this purpose. The forms were then brought to the cashier and paid for. A receipt was issued indicating where to wait for the items to be picked up from the storeroom.

The company is renowned for its innovative design and customer-centric approach. In recent times, it has diversified its digital channels, offered an app for mobile devices, and various smart appliances.

Debenhams

The first Debenhams store opened in 1778 on Wigmore Street in the heart of London's West End. The company grew, opening new shops throughout the UK. The firm changed names many times over the years, most recently to Clark & Debenhams and then to Debenhams and Freebody.

The company grew rapidly after the first world war. Numerous acquisitions were made, including Knightsbridge retailer Harvey Nichols in 1920. Stores remained independent while operating under the Debenhams name but purchasing, warehousing, and other functions were centralized.

In 1985, the Burton Group acquired the brand. Then, Online Clothes Shopping Near Me Arcadia merged with it. In 1998, the retailer resigned from the Burton Group to return to the stock market. The noughties saw the appointment of chief executive Belinda Earl who introduced exclusive designer clothing brands under the Designers at Debenhams brand. The company also opened its first store outside of London in Cheltenham.

House of Fraser

House of Fraser is the most well-known department store in the UK. It has multiple branches and sells clothing and homeware. It was purchased in 2018 by Sports Direct founder Mike Ashley however, the company is facing a number of challenges.

One of them is Brexit which caused economic uncertainty and slowed consumer spending. It's also challenging to compete with online retailers. The company's sales have been hurt by the higher cost of shipping and currency fluctuations.

The flagship 318 Oxford Street branch was earmarked to close in 2018 but it was saved by Sports Direct owner Mike Ashley. The new owners plan to convert the Art Deco-style building into an office space and shops, as well as a rooftop restaurant. Fraser Group, the parent company of HoF blames its troubles on outdated business taxes and warns that more closings are inevitable without reform.

AO

AO is one of the biggest companies to emerge out of the North West over the past two decades. The Bolton-based firm, which was founded by John Roberts, is listed on the London Stock Exchange and specialises in white goods and electronics. It was originally known as Appliances Online it was founded after Roberts won a PS1 bet with a friend on whether he could change the method of buying white goods online. Since the time, AO Business, AO Finance, and AO Mobile have been added to the company. It also has an in-house delivery system and its own fridge recycling plant.
